Summary
A vulnerability classified as problematic has been found in Wickr Secret Messenger 2.2.1. This affects an unknown function of the file CFLite.dll. This manipulation of the argument name/password causes denial of service. It is possible to launch the attack on the local host. Additionally, an exploit exists.
Details
A vulnerability was found in Wickr Secret Messenger 2.2.1 (Messaging Software). It has been declared as problematic. Affected by this vulnerability is some unknown processing of the file CFLite.dll. The manipulation of the argument name/password with an unknown input leads to a denial of service vulnerability. The CWE definition for the vulnerability is CWE-404. The product does not release or incorrectly releases a resource before it is made available for re-use. As an impact it is known to affect availability.
The weakness was released 10/27/2016 as Wickr Inc - When honesty disappears behind the VCP Mountain as confirmed blog post (Website). It is possible to read the advisory at vulnerability-db.com. The attack can be launched remotely. The exploitation doesn't need any form of authentication. Technical details and also a public exploit are known.
After immediately, there has been an exploit disclosed. It is possible to download the exploit at vulnerability-db.com. It is declared as proof-of-concept.
There is no information about possible countermeasures known. It may be suggested to replace the affected object with an alternative product.
